There are more than 1 million street children in the Philippines and an estimated 400,000 just in Manila. While driving through the crowded streets of Manila, I encountered a staggering number of children begging in the dangerous streets. As I looked into the eyes of a rain soaked, little Filipino girl begging on the street corner, I heard God speak to me, "If you build it, I will use it not only for the salvation of children, but I will use those children to make a difference in their city and country."
I didn't know the first thing about starting an orphanage or how it would all come together, but as I continued to pray about it, God reassured me that He would help me and direct me. And that is exactly what He did. Over the next several years, we found the resources and people we needed to make Ima's Home a reality. We found an amazing in-country director to run the home. We purchased land, built our facility, acquired staff, and opened our doors in 2013 to thirteen children.
Today, Ima's Home has provided more than 200 children a place to find safety and love in Christ, to find freedom from their past, to discover their purpose, and eventually make a difference in their community and in their nation. We are just getting started. The best is yet to come!
